Finally got in my first mountain trip on the 165 2.75" boost, the sled is totally stock including clutching it has about 700 miles on it and I feel it is lacking in throttle response also. Went to Revy and had excellent 24-36" fresh powder for 1 day and heavier snow another. I'm 58 years old, 5'8" and weigh about 160 lbs. My last 5 sleds have been axys 163's, 3-800's and 2-850's all with with low bars, Silber turbos, Raptor shocks, 36" trencher front ends, and offset spindles where I rode with various widths from 34" to 36", I also rode with and without the swaybar at times. Riding with the 34" front and no swaybar made it a challenge to not over-ride the sled, at times it would move quicker than I could react to so I went back to the swaybar. I found the boost to feel very heavy on the front end and the ski shocks felt very firm even with the clickers backed right off. I felt it took more effort to get the sled on edge than my previous setups. I did remove the link on the swaybar about 1/4 of the way into the day, increased the preload on the center shock, and played with clicker settings. That did help but it still has a way to go before I'll be happy with it. One of the guys had a 2022 165 expert Doo and when I rode it it felt like it had power steering compared to my heavy steering boost, it took less effort to initiate a downhill turn and to get on edge. I'm a Polaris guy so I would like to reduce the heavy feeling and get this boost to react with less effort than it currently takes. I'm not into doing all the fancy tricks, I just want to fine tune this sled to make it easier to ride in the trees by making it feel lighter on the front and require less effort to maneuver. I also want to improve the bottom end response so I'm looking for some clutching to make it rippier without giving up on the top end. I plan on installing a Khaos limiter strap.
